This blog site post checks out the rationale, benefits, and considerations involved in employing a hacker for cybersecurity purposes.What is Ethical Hacking?Ethical hacking describes the authorized practice of probing a computer system, network, or application to determine vulnerabilities that malicious hackers could make use of. Unlike their unethical counterparts, ethical hackers get specific approval to carry out these examinations and work to improve general security. Proactive Risk AssessmentHiring an ethical hacker allows organizations to identify potential weak points in their systems before cybercriminals exploit them. By conducting penetration tests and vulnerability evaluations, they can proactively resolve security spaces.2. Compliance and RegulationsNumerous industries undergo regulatory requirements, such as HIPAA for healthcare or PCI DSS for payment processing. Ethical hackers can ensure compliance with these policies by assessing the security procedures in place.3. Enhanced Security CultureUsing ethical hackers fosters a security-aware culture within the organization. They can supply training and workshops to enhance basic worker awareness about cybersecurity dangers and best practices.4. Cost-EffectivenessInvesting in ethical hacking may seem like an additional expense, but in truth, it can conserve organizations from considerable expenses associated with data breaches, recovery, and reputational damage.5. Tailored Security SolutionsEthical hackers can provide customized options that line up with an organization's specific security needs. Here are some comprehensive steps and considerations:Step 1: Define Your ObjectivesPlainly lay out the goals you wish to attain by hiring an ethical hacker. Do you need a penetration test, incident response, or security assessments? Specifying objectives will notify your recruiting procedure.Action 2: Assess QualificationsSearch for candidates with market accreditations, such as Certified Ethical Hacker (CEH),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P), or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P). These certifications show knowledge in cybersecurity.Table 2: Popular Certifications for Ethical HackersAccreditationDescriptionCertified Ethical Hacker (CEH)Focuses on the important abilities of ethical hacking.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P)Hands-on penetration screening certification.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P)Covers a broad spectrum of security subjects.GIAC Penetration Tester (GPEN)Specialized accreditation in penetration screening.CompTIA Security+Entry-level certification in network security.Step 3: Evaluate ExperienceEvaluation their work experience and ability to work on diverse tasks. Search for case studies or reviews that show their previous success.Step 4: Conduct InterviewsDuring the interview process, examine their problem-solving abilities and ask scenario-based concerns. This evaluation will offer insight into how they approach real-world cybersecurity difficulties.Step 5: Check ReferencesDo not ignore the value of recommendations. Just how much does employing an ethical hacker expense?Costs vary depending upon the scope of the job, the hacker's experience, and the complexity of your systems. Anticipate to pay anywhere from a couple of hundred to several thousand dollars for comprehensive assessments.2. What types of services do ethical hackers offer?Ethical hackers offer a series of services, including penetration testing, vulnerability assessment, malware analysis, security audits, and occurrence reaction preparation.3. The length of time does a penetration test typically take?The duration of a penetration test differs based on the scope and complexity of the environment being evaluated. Normally, an extensive test can take several days to weeks.4. How frequently should organizations hire an ethical hacker?Organizations ought to consider hiring ethical hackers at least each year or whenever substantial modifications take place in their IT infrastructure.5.
